The 'url' package is a Node.js core module that provides utilities for URL resolution and parsing. It offers similar functionalities to @aws-sdk/util-format-url, such as constructing and parsing URLs, but it is more general-purpose and not specifically tailored for AWS services.
The 'query-string' package is a utility for parsing and stringifying URL query strings. It provides more advanced features for handling query parameters compared to @aws-sdk/util-format-url, but it does not handle the full URL construction.
The 'url-parse' package is a lightweight URL parser that works in both Node.js and the browser. It offers similar URL parsing and formatting capabilities as @aws-sdk/util-format-url but is designed to be more lightweight and versatile.
